Another mistake people make is to fall into the trap of false economy. They begin with the right intentions by searching for a lower rate of interest for their mortgage. What this means is that their monthly payments become lower. The mistake they make is to think theyve got more money in their pocket. In affect this is a false economy. Instead of settling for more money in your pocket and still enduring a 10 year (or whatever) term loan ,why not use this extra money to increase payment on the capital of your loan?

This simple technique is called Mortgage Acceleration The Banks and Building Societies know all about Mortgage Acceleration they just dont mention it because it loses them lots of money in interest payments!

If you increase the capital payments of your mortgage every month youre paying off the entire loan quicker. If you can shave 2 years off your loan youve not only shortened your mortgage by 2 years youll have saved yourself a packet in interest charges. A 25-year 50k mortgage repaid 16 years early could save you over 60k in interest! (dependant on the interest rate) Ask your Bank or Building Society about Mortgage Acceleration and see the look of loss on their face!

Dont settle for a lower rate of interest and extend your loan payments thinking that youre saving money, youre not. You are only extending your debt! You need to pay off this loan as quickly as possible whilst the interest rates are low. The longer you take to pay off your mortgage the more interest rate the Bank or Building Society will take from you. Talking of your mortgage, if you currently have an Endowment policy running alongside your mortgage than investigate this policy thoroughly. Most endowment policies are useless in todays interest market. What this means is that when your mortgage term ends there may be insufficient funds in your endowment policy to pay off what you owe to the lender. If this is true than your lender will be knocking on your door for this short fall. If you cant afford to pay than you could lose your home after 25 years or more of payments! Recently I read that some Endowment policies were running a short fall of up to 13000! If this happens to you youll owe your lender 13k plus interest!

The smartest mortgage you can take is a straight repayment mortgage. As well as paying the interest back to your lender you are also paying the capital off from the offset, therefore reducing the total amount you owe quicker.
